Description
Nestled between lake and mountains in Allinges, in the heart of the Chablais region, the Brasserie du Léman passionately produces 100% organic beers with natural bubbles, sustained by the alchemy of refermentation!
All raw materials are organically grown. Over 95% of these ingredients are sourced from France.
